Coach Rosemary Mugadza has selected the provisional squad for the inaugural Under-20 COSAFA Women’s Championship to be played from 1 to 11 August in South Africa.
The team convened on 23 July for camp and has already commenced training in Harare.
Zimbabwe is in group A with the hosts, Namibia and Mozambique.
Zimbabwe will play the hosts on the opening day at 2 pm and the other fixtures are as follows:
Zimbabwe vs Mozambique – 3 August
Namibia vs Zimbabwe – 5 August
The Under-20 team will leave for South Africa on 29 July together with the Mighty Warriors who are also playing in the senior tournament also being played in Port Elizabeth..
